Preparing for a Model United Nations (MUN) requires thorough research on the country you represent. Start by gathering essential data from reputable sources like the CIA World Factbook and the United Nations website. Explore your country’s stance on key issues through the Permanent Mission to the UN and familiarize yourself with its profile on BBC Country Profiles. Understanding your country’s history, culture, and current events is crucial to articulating its position effectively during sessions. Utilize these resources to enhance your knowledge and confidence.
